In the summer of 1975, I had the pleasure of
Visiting the Soviet Union with the New York Jazz Repertory Company
The Soviet government had heard a program that we had done in Carnegie Hall
Some months before, on the music of Louis Armstrong
So, we took a group on the direction of the ticker Hymen
We tuned the Soviet Union playing the music of Louis Armstrong
And I was asked to do some of the vocals during the tour
And I'd like to do one of 'em for you, and it's a tune called: "When You're Smiling "
